-
Notifications
You must be signed in to change notification settings - Fork 12
27 lines (24 loc) · 913 Bytes
/
nightly.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
name: nightly
on:
workflow_dispatch:
schedule:
- cron: '0 2 * * *'
jobs:
test-main:
name: Nightly Testing (dev-main)
uses: ./.github/workflows/_test.yaml
with:
php-version: 8.3
typo3-version: dev-main@dev
unit-coverage-name: coverage-unit-main
functional-coverage-name: coverage-functional-main
composer-remove: phpstan/phpstan saschaegerer/phpstan-typo3
composer-require: 'typo3/cms-backend:"dev-main@dev" typo3/cms-core:"dev-main@dev" typo3/cms-extbase:"dev-main@dev" typo3/cms-filelist:"dev-main@dev" typo3/cms-fluid:"dev-main@dev" typo3/cms-frontend:"dev-main@dev" composer/class-map-generator'
test-lts:
name: Nightly Testing (current LTS)
uses: ./.github/workflows/_test.yaml
with:
php-version: 8.3
typo3-version: '^12'
unit-coverage-name: coverage-unit-lts
functional-coverage-name: coverage-functional-lts